Skip to main content

Local 940X90

Best web ui for ollama


  1. Best web ui for ollama. com/ollama-webui/ollama-webui. 尽管 Ollama 能够在本地部署模型服务,以供其他程序调用,但其原生的对话界面是在命令行中进行的,用户无法方便与 AI 模型进行交互,因此,通常推荐利用第三方的 WebUI 应用来使用 Ollama, 以获得更好的体验。 五款开源 Ollama GUI 客户端推荐 1. For more information, be sure to check out our Open WebUI Documentation. . Addison Best. With Ollama and Docker set up, run the following command: docker run-d-p 3000:3000 openwebui/ollama Check Docker Desktop to confirm that Open Web UI is Not exactly a terminal UI, but llama. With a recent update, you can easily download models from the Jan UI. Example. Jul 31, 2024 · Ollama Desktop UI. AutoAWQ, HQQ, and AQLM are also supported through the Transformers loader. 🔒 Backend Reverse Proxy Support: Bolster security through direct communication between Open WebUI backend and Ollama. Help: Ollama + Obsidian, Smart Second Brain + Open web UI @ the same time on Old HP Omen with a Nvidia 1050 4g I followed NetworkChuks host "ALL your AI locally". The idea of this project is to create an easy-to-use and friendly web interface that you can use to interact with the growing number of free and open LLMs such as Llama 3 and Phi3. 3-nightly on a Mac M1, 16GB Sonoma 14 . Apr 2, 2024 · Unlock the potential of Ollama, an open-source LLM, for text generation, code completion, translation, and more. Aug 5, 2024 · Exploring LLMs locally can be greatly accelerated with a local web UI. The Open WebUI project (spawned out of ollama originally) works seamlessly with ollama to provide a web-based LLM workspace for experimenting with prompt engineering, retrieval augmented generation (RAG), and tool use. 🔐 Auth Header Support: Effortlessly enhance security by adding Authorization headers to Ollama requests directly from the web UI settings, ensuring access to secured Ollama servers. Copy the URL provided by ngrok (forwarding url), which now hosts your Ollama Web UI application. Below, you can see a couple of prompts we used and the results it produced. But it is possible to run using WSL 2. There are so many web services using LLM like ChatGPT, while some tools are developed to run the LLM locally. This is faster than running the Web Ui directly. Jun 5, 2024 · If you do not need anything fancy, or special integration support, but more of a bare-bones experience with an accessible web UI, Ollama UI is the one. Import one or more model into Ollama using Open WebUI: Click the “+” next to the models drop-down in the UI. So, you can keep the Ollama server on a Aug 5, 2024 · This guide introduces Ollama, a tool for running large language models (LLMs) locally, and its integration with Open Web UI. Before delving into the solution let us know what is the problem first, since Ollama GUI is a web interface for ollama. Mar 10, 2024 · Step 9 → Access Ollama Web UI Remotely. Now you can chat with OLLAMA by running ollama run llama3 then ask a question to try it out! Using OLLAMA from the terminal is a cool experience, but it gets even better when you connect your OLLAMA instance to a web interface. ️🔢 Full Markdown and LaTeX Support : Elevate your LLM experience with comprehensive Markdown and LaTeX capabilities for enriched interaction. You can also use any model available from HuggingFace or May 1, 2024 · Open Web UI (Formerly Ollama Web UI) is an open-source and self-hosted web interface for interacting with large language models (LLM). cpp has a vim plugin file inside the examples folder. cpp in CPU mode. Contribute to ollama-ui/ollama-ui development by creating an account on GitHub. Alternatively, go to Settings -> Models -> “Pull a model from Ollama. Explore the models available on Ollama’s library. com. 1 405B — How to Use May 7, 2024 · 12 Tools to Provide a Web UI for Ollama. The easiest way to install OpenWebUI is with Docker. The local user UI accesses the server through the API. Some of the advantages it offers compared to other Ollama WebUIs are as follows: Performance and Speed: Braina is more efficient with system resources. ai, a tool that enables running Large Language Models (LLMs) on your local machine. 1. While llama. The reason ,I am not sure. It highlights the cost and security benefits of local LLM deployment, providing setup instructions for Ollama and demonstrating how to use Open Web UI for enhanced model interaction. It offers a straightforward and user-friendly interface, making it an accessible choice for users. OLLAMA takes this a step further by allowing you to build LLM-powered web apps right on your local machine. cpp is an option, I Jul 8, 2024 · TLDR Discover how to run AI models locally with Ollama, a free, open-source solution that allows for private and secure model execution without internet connection. Apr 28, 2024 · Deploying Ollama and Open Web UI on Kubernetes After learning about self-hosted AI models and tools recently, I decided to run an experiment to find out if our team could self-host AI… May 16 Retrieval Augmented Generation (RAG) is a a cutting-edge technology that enhances the conversational capabilities of chatbots by incorporating context from diverse sources. docker run -d -v ollama:/root/. It works by retrieving relevant information from a wide range of sources such as local and remote documents, web content, and even multimedia sources like YouTube videos. Since both docker containers are sitting on the same host we can refer to the ollama container name ‘ollama-server’ in the URL. Apr 14, 2024 · Ollama 的不足. LobeChat 6 days ago · If you would like to give best experience for multiple users, for example to improve response time and token/s you can scale the Ollama app. Downloading Ollama Models. cpp (through llama-cpp-python), ExLlamaV2, AutoGPTQ, and TensorRT-LLM. One of these options is Ollama WebUI, which can be found on GitHub – Ollama WebUI. See the complete OLLAMA model list here. Ollama Web UI: A User-Friendly Web Interface for Chat Interactions 👋. I don't know about Windows, but I'm using linux and it's been pretty great. NOTE: Edited on 11 May 2014 to reflect the naming change from ollama-webui to open-webui. Use models from Open AI, Claude, Perplexity, Ollama, and HuggingFace in a unified interface. Upload images or input commands for AI to analyze or generate content. cpp, koboldai) Feb 18, 2024 · OpenWebUI (Formerly Ollama WebUI) is a ChatGPT-Style Web Interface for Ollama. Ollama Web UI is another great option - https://github. Deploy with a single click. I use llama. One of Ollama’s cool features is its API, which you can query. The retrieved text is then combined with a At the bottom of last link, you can access: Open Web-UI aka Ollama Open Web-UI. Llama 3. Mar 17, 2024 · # enable virtual environment in `ollama` source directory cd ollama source . Web development has come a long way, and the integration of machine learning models has opened up a plethora of opportunities. Oct 20, 2023 · Image generated using DALL-E 3. cpp to open the API function and run on the server. Open WebUI is an extensible, self-hosted interface for AI that adapts to your workflow, all while operating entirely offline; Supported LLM runners include Ollama and OpenAI-compatible APIs. It is a simple HTML-based UI that lets you use Ollama on your browser. ChatGPT-Style Web Interface for Ollama 🦙. llama3; mistral; llama2; Ollama API If you want to integrate Ollama into your own projects, Ollama offers both its own API as well as an OpenAI Fully-featured, beautiful web interface for Ollama LLMs - built with NextJS. To set up Open WebUI, follow the steps in their 对于程序的规范来说,只要东西一多,我们就需要一个集中管理的平台,如管理python 的pip,管理js库的npm等等,而这种平台是大家争着抢着想实现的,这就有了Ollama。 Ollama. 🔄 Update All Ollama Models: Easily update locally installed models all at once with a convenient button, streamlining model management. It has look&feel similar to ChatGPT UI, offers an easy way to install models and choose them before beginning a dialog. venv/bin/activate # set env variabl INIT_INDEX which determines weather needs to create the index export INIT_INDEX=true The video explains step by step how to run llms or Large language models locally using OLLAMA Web UI! You will learn:1. Here are some models that I’ve used that I recommend for general purposes. There is a growing list of models to choose from. Line 21 - Connect to the Web UI on port 3010. It’s inspired by the OpenAI ChatGPT web UI, very user friendly, and feature-rich. Using Curl to Communicate with Ollama on your Raspberry Pi. Features ⭐. To get started, ensure you have Docker Desktop installed. 🔗 External Ollama Server Connection : Seamlessly link to an external Ollama server hosted on a different address by configuring the environment variable May 23, 2024 · Once Ollama finishes starting up the Llama3 model on your Raspberry Pi, you can start communicating with the language model. Jan 21, 2024 · Accessible Web User Interface (WebUI) Options: Ollama doesn’t come with an official web UI, but there are a few available options for web UIs that can be used. Using this API, you Apr 29, 2024 · Section 5: Building Web Apps with OLLAMA Transforming Web Development with OLLAMA. 📱 Progressive Web App (PWA) for Mobile: Enjoy a native app-like experience on your mobile device with our PWA, providing offline access on localhost and a seamless user interface. Also check our sibling project, OllamaHub, where you can discover, download, and explore customized Modelfiles for Ollama! 🦙🔍. Because I'm an idiot, I asked ChatGPT to explain your reply to me. 📥🗑️ Download/Delete Models: Easily download or remove models directly from the web UI. Prerequisites. 🛠 Installation. User Registrations: Subsequent sign-ups start with Pending status, requiring Administrator approval for access. When it came to running LLMs, my usual approach was to open Welcome to my Ollama Chat, this is an interface for the Official ollama CLI to make it easier to chat. I got the Ubuntu server running on the laptop so I could get the most out of the old laptop. And from there you can download new AI models for a bunch of funs! Then select a desired model from the dropdown menu at the top of the main page, such as "llava". Get to know the Ollama local model framework, understand its strengths and weaknesses, and recommend 5 open-source free Ollama WebUI clients to enhance the user experience. Now the TLDR: I managed to get the Ollama CA docker working. May 21, 2024 · Open WebUI, the Ollama web UI, is a powerful and flexible tool for interacting with language models in a self-hosted environment. For instructions on how to set this up, please see this tutorial Apr 21, 2024 · Then clicking on “models” on the left side of the modal, then pasting in a name of a model from the Ollama registry. Open WebUI is an extensible, feature-rich, and user-friendly self-hosted WebUI designed to operate entirely offline. Com o Ollama em mãos, vamos realizar a primeira execução local de um LLM, para isso iremos utilizar o llama3 da Meta, presente na biblioteca de LLMs do Ollama. May 29, 2024 · OLLAMA has several models you can pull down and use. Ollama 对于管理开源大模型是认真的,使用起来非常的简单,先看下如何使用: github地址 May 8, 2024 · Once you have Ollama installed, have downloaded one or more LLMs with it, you can enjoy using your own locally hosted LLMs from the terminal / command-line of your local machine. How to install Ollama Web UI using Do Apr 4, 2024 · Learn to Connect Automatic1111 (Stable Diffusion Webui) with Open-Webui+Ollama+Stable Diffusion Prompt Generator, Once Connected then ask for Prompt and Click on Generate Image. Ollama running ‘llama3’ LLM in the terminal. Note that here you should use the EFS (RWX access) storage class instead of the EBS (RWO access) storage class for the storage of ollama models. Long version: The CA docker template for Ollama enables you to map a container path for the config volume, which is where your models will eventually be located, but that's not apparent at first because there's nothing actually there yet. - jakobhoeg/nextjs-ollama-llm-ui Sep 5, 2024 · In this article, you will learn how to locally access AI LLMs such as Meta Llama 3, Mistral, Gemma, Phi, etc. Not visually pleasing, but much more controllable than any other UI I used (text-generation-ui, chat mode llama. embeddings({ model: 'mxbai-embed-large', prompt: 'Llamas are members of the camelid family', }) Ollama also integrates with popular tooling to support embeddings workflows such as LangChain and LlamaIndex. , from your Linux terminal by using an Ollama, and then access the chat interface from your browser using the Open WebUI. Jul 12, 2024 · Line 17 - environment variable that tells Web UI which port to connect to on the Ollama Server. May 25, 2024 · If you run the ollama image with the command below, you will start the Ollama on your computer memory and CPU. I feel that the most efficient is the original code llama. Setting Up Open Web UI. If you don’t… Apr 8, 2024 · $ ollama -v ollama version is 0. Requests made to the '/ollama/api' route from the web UI are seamlessly redirected to Ollama from the backend, enhancing overall system security. Learn installation, model management, and interaction via command line or the Open Web UI, enhancing user experience with a visual interface. I often prefer the approach of doing things the hard way because it offers the best learning experience. Simple HTML UI for Ollama. Open-WebUI (former ollama-webui) is alright, and provides a lot of things out of the box, like using PDF or Word documents as a context, however I like it less and less because since ollama-webui it accumulated some bloat and the container size is ~2Gb, with quite rapid release cycle hence watchtower has to download ~2Gb every second night to Harbor (Containerized LLM Toolkit with Ollama as default backend) Go-CREW (Powerful Offline RAG in Golang) PartCAD (CAD model generation with OpenSCAD and CadQuery) Ollama4j Web UI - Java-based Web UI for Ollama built with Vaadin, Spring Boot and Ollama4j; PyOllaMx - macOS application capable of chatting with both Ollama and Apple MLX models. In this exchange, the act of the responder attributing a claim to you that you did not actually make is an example of "strawmanning. Apr 14, 2024 · Five Excellent Free Ollama WebUI Client Recommendations. Unfortunately Ollama for Windows is still in development. It includes futures such as: Improved interface design & user friendly; Auto check if ollama is running (NEW, Auto start ollama server) ⏰; Multiple conversations 💬; Detect which models are available to use 📋 Apr 8, 2024 · ollama. Aug 5, 2024 · This self-hosted web UI is designed to operate offline and supports various LLM runners, including Ollama. If you want a nicer web UI experience, that’s where the next steps come in to get setup with OpenWebUI. in. May 22, 2024 · ollama and Open-WebUI performs like ChatGPT in local. ⬆️ GGUF File Model Creation: Effortlessly create Ollama models by uploading GGUF files directly from the web Dec 4, 2023 · LLM Server: The most critical component of this app is the LLM server. Chat with files, understand images, and access various AI models offline. Being a desktop software it offers many advantages over the Web UIs. 30. Admin Creation: The first account created on Open WebUI gains Administrator privileges, controlling user management and system settings. Line 22-23 - Avoids the need for this container to use ‘host Backend Reverse Proxy Support: Bolster security through direct communication between Open WebUI backend and Ollama. It Mar 12, 2024 · Jan UI realtime demo: Jan v0. This example walks through building a retrieval augmented generation (RAG) application using Ollama and embedding models. 4. Most importantly, it works great with Ollama. Unlike the other Web based UIs (Open WebUI for LLMs or Ollama WebUI), Braina is a desktop software. May 3, 2024 · Open WebUI (Formerly Ollama WebUI) 👋. Generative AI. This key feature eliminates the need to expose Ollama over LAN. ollama -p 11434:11434 --name ollama ollama/ollama ⚠️ Warning This is not recommended if you have a dedicated GPU since running LLMs on with this way will consume your computer memory and CPU. The best thing is that you can access it from other devices on your sub-network. " This term refers to misrepresenting or distorting someone else's position or argument to m May 5, 2024 · In this article, I’ll share how I’ve enhanced my experience using my own private version of ChatGPT to ask about documents. ” OpenWebUI Import Multiple backends for text generation in a single UI and API, including Transformers, llama. Paste the URL into the browser of your mobile device or Aug 8, 2024 · This extension hosts an ollama-ui web server on localhost Feb 10, 2024 · Dalle 3 Generated image. It supports various LLM runners, including Ollama and OpenAI-compatible APIs. Thanks to Ollama, we have a robust LLM Server that can be set up locally, even on a laptop. See how Ollama works and get started with Ollama WebUI in just two minutes without pod installations! #LLM #Ollama #textgeneration #codecompletion #translation #OllamaWebUI Feb 7, 2024 · Ollama is fantastic opensource project and by far the easiest to run LLM on any device. 🔗 External Ollama Server Connection : Seamlessly link to an external Ollama server hosted on a different address by configuring the environment variable May 10, 2024 · 6. It even 🔒 Backend Reverse Proxy Support: Bolster security through direct communication between Open WebUI backend and Ollama. esfbax hahzat sjdvwwb iua holuf wnhkf lzazlr jicso tagxj aiigq